universal donor [¦yü·nə¦vər·səl ′dō·nər] (immunology) An individual of O blood group; can give blood to persons of all blood types. How to thank TFD for its existence? Tell a friend about us, add a link to this page, add the site to iGoogle, or visit webmaster's page for free fun content. |
